The Morning After

Calgary Flames 6 - Ottawa Senators 3

Tidbits

-First Of The Year: Juuso Valimaki finally got on the score sheet today with this first goal of the season, putting the Flames up 1-0 just four minutes into the first period. The goal is the second of his NHL career and his seventh point of the season.

-First Shortie: The Flames PK looked more like a PP unit today and were rewarded, FINALLY, for all their hard work. Mikael Backlund was able to find Andrew Mangiapane who would find the back of the net, scoring his 8th of the season and the Flames first short handed goal of the year.

-Makin’ Up: On Thursday night the Flames and Sens didn’t take a penalty during their game. Saturday? Much different story. All totaled, the Flames and Senators collected 10 penalties, with Calgary scoring one out of four times and Ottawa scoring three out of six times.
